Articles / Automate KPI Reports from Multiple Sources with AI 2026

Automate KPI Reports from Multiple Sources with AI 2026

Explore automate kpi reports from multiple sources with ai 2026 with practical guidance on features, use cases, and implementation strategies.

Eoin McMillan

Eoin McMillan

March 13, 2026 • 19 min read

Automating KPI reports from multiple data sources in 2026 no longer requires a full BI stack. With AI spreadsheets like Sourcetable, you can connect directly to databases and SaaS tools, use AI to clean and join data, build reusable KPI templates, and schedule recurring updates, dramatically reducing manual reporting work. This guide walks you through the exact steps to replace manual processes with automated, AI-assisted workflows, as detailed in our comprehensive guide on How to Automate KPI and Recurring Reports with AI Spreadsheets in 2026.

Why Are KPI Reports So Hard to Maintain Manually?

Manually maintaining KPI reports across multiple sources is time-consuming, error-prone, and inefficient. Analysts often juggle data from SaaS platforms like Salesforce, marketing tools, databases, and spreadsheets, leading to several common challenges:

  • Data Fragmentation: Key metrics are scattered across different systems, requiring manual copy-pasting or complex exports. According to operations and RevOps benchmarks, analysts spend up to 40% of their time simply gathering and updating data for recurring reports.

  • Human Error: Manual data entry and formula creation are prone to mistakes. Data indicates that manually maintained KPI spreadsheets have error rates that can skew business decisions.

  • Lack of Real-Time Insights: Manual processes cause reporting lags, meaning stakeholders view outdated information. 2026 tooling surveys reveal that teams demand faster, more frequent updates to stay agile.

  • Scalability Issues: As your business grows, adding new data sources or KPIs exponentially increases the manual workload. This friction often delays adoption by non-technical team members who need these insights.

Automating this process is no longer a luxury but a necessity for data-driven teams.

What Tools Should You Use for KPI Automation in 2026?

Choosing the right toolset is critical for successful KPI automation. While traditional BI stacks (like Tableau + ETL pipelines) are powerful, they are often complex and expensive. In 2026, AI-powered spreadsheets like Sourcetable offer a compelling alternative by combining familiar interfaces with intelligent automation.

Key considerations when selecting a tool:

  • Connectivity: Can it connect directly to all your data sources (e.g., PostgreSQL, Google Analytics, Shopify) without custom code?

  • AI Capabilities: Does it use AI to suggest data transformations, clean messy datasets, and generate formulas?

  • Automation Features: Can you schedule data refreshes and report distribution to email or Slack?

  • Collaboration: Is it easy for cross-functional teams to view and interact with live dashboards?

According to the KPI Software: Top 14 Platforms Reviewed for 2026 - SimpleKPI.com, there is a clear trend toward platforms that reduce technical debt and empower business users. AI spreadsheets sit uniquely at this intersection.

KPI Automation Tools Comparison 2026

Feature AI Spreadsheet (e.g., Sourcetable) Traditional BI Stack
Setup & Learning Curve Low - Uses spreadsheet UI High - Requires SQL/ETL knowledge
Cost Lower (SaaS subscription) High (licenses + engineering time)
Real-Time Data Updates Yes, with automated refreshes Yes, but requires pipeline maintenance
AI-Powered Data Cleaning Built-in Manual or separate tool required
Report Distribution Native scheduling to email/Slack Often requires additional setup
Best For Analysts, operators, growth teams Data engineering teams & large enterprises

How to Automate KPI Reports from Multiple Sources

Follow this step-by-step process to automate your KPI reporting using an AI spreadsheet. This high-level overview mirrors the detailed steps you'll find in our pillar guide, How to Automate KPI and Recurring Reports with AI Spreadsheets in 2026.

  1. Connect Your Data Sources: Link your database and SaaS tools directly to the spreadsheet.

  2. Clean and Merge Data with AI: Use AI assistants to unify schemas and handle inconsistencies.

  3. Build KPI Calculations: Define your metrics with AI-generated formulas.

  4. Design Reusable Templates: Create a dashboard layout for recurring use.

  5. Schedule Automated Refreshes: Set your data to update hourly, daily, or weekly.

  6. Configure Distribution: Automate report sharing via email, Slack, or web links.

  7. Validate and Monitor: Implement checks to ensure data accuracy over time.

Step 1: Connect Your Data Sources

Begin by connecting your AI spreadsheet to all relevant data sources. In Sourcetable, you can use native connectors for databases (e.g., MySQL, BigQuery) and SaaS applications (e.g., HubSpot, Stripe).

  • Action: Navigate to the 'Connections' section and authenticate each tool. For databases, provide your connection string; for SaaS apps, use OAuth.

  • Pro Tip: Start with your 2-3 most critical sources to validate the workflow before scaling. According to guides on how to connect SQL databases to cloud spreadsheets, direct connections eliminate manual CSV exports.

  • Outcome: Your spreadsheet now has live tables representing each data source, ready for analysis.

Step 2: Clean and Merge Data with AI

Raw data is often messy. Use your AI spreadsheet's built-in intelligence to clean and join datasets automatically.

  • Action: Select the tables you want to combine. Use AI prompts like "Clean this customer data" or "Join sales data with marketing spend on date." The AI will suggest transformations such as removing duplicates, standardizing formats, and creating merge keys.

  • Pro Tip: Always review the AI's suggestions. As noted in AI-Generated Insights: A 2026 Guide to Data Validation - ThoughtSpot, human validation remains crucial for trust.

  • Outcome: A unified, clean dataset sits in your spreadsheet, forming the foundation for accurate KPIs.

Step 3: Build KPI Calculations with AI Assistance

Define your key performance indicators using formulas. AI can help generate complex calculations without manual syntax errors.

  • Action: In a new sheet, start typing your KPI logic (e.g., "Monthly Recurring Revenue"). Use the AI formula assistant to generate accurate Excel-compatible formulas. For example, =SUMIFS(Subscriptions!Amount, Subscriptions!Status, "Active").

  • Pro Tip: Structure your calculations in a dedicated 'Calculations' tab to keep your dashboard clean. Reference the unified data from Step 2.

  • Outcome: All core KPIs are calculated dynamically from the live data, updating automatically as new information flows in.

Step 4: Design Reusable Report Templates

Create a dashboard template that visualizes your KPIs for easy consumption. This template will be used for all future reports.

  • Action: Use charts, graphs, and pivot tables within the spreadsheet to visualize data. Leverage AI to suggest the best chart types for your metrics. Position key metrics (e.g., Revenue, CAC, Churn Rate) prominently.

  • Pro Tip: Follow best practices from How to Automate Data Visualization for Monthly Stakeholder Reports by grouping related metrics and using consistent formatting.

  • Outcome: A professional, scannable dashboard that can be duplicated or used as a base for each reporting period.

Step 5: Schedule Automated Data Refreshes

Ensure your report always shows the latest data by setting up automatic refreshes.

  • Action: In your AI spreadsheet's settings, configure refresh intervals (e.g., every 4 hours, daily at 9 AM). The system will automatically pull the latest data from all connected sources.

  • Pro Tip: Align refresh schedules with your business cycles. Sales dashboards might refresh hourly, while financial reports may only need daily updates.

  • Outcome: Your KPI dashboard is now a living document that updates without any manual intervention.

Step 6: Configure Distribution and Alerts

Automate the delivery of reports to stakeholders and set up alerts for critical metric thresholds.

  • Action: Use the 'Share' or 'Publish' features to schedule email reports to specific recipients or post to a Slack channel. You can also set alerts (e.g., "Notify me if MRR drops by 5%").

  • Pro Tip: Segment your audience. Executives might receive a weekly summary PDF, while the operations team accesses a live link. Research on AI Marketing Automation shows automated distribution boosts team adoption.

  • Outcome: Insights reach the right people at the right time, driving faster decision-making.

Step 7: Validate and Monitor Your Automated Reports

Implement a process to regularly check the accuracy of your automated system and monitor for anomalies.

  • Action: Schedule a monthly audit where you spot-check a sample of KPI calculations against source data. Use the AI to flag outliers or unexpected changes in trends.

  • Pro Tip: Create a 'Validation' tab with checksums or comparison formulas that alert you to data breaks. This proactive step is essential for maintaining trust in automated systems.

  • Outcome: A reliable, self-correcting reporting system that frees your team for analysis rather than data wrangling.

How Do You Build Reusable KPI Templates and Dashboards?

Building a reusable template is about designing for consistency and scalability. Start by identifying the core KPIs that every report must include, such as revenue, customer acquisition cost, and conversion rates.

Best practices for template design:

  • Modular Layout: Use separate sheets or sections for data sources, calculations, and visualizations. This makes updates easier.

  • Dynamic Date Ranges: Build your formulas to automatically adjust to the current month, quarter, or year using functions like TODAY() or EOMONTH().

  • Branding and Clarity: Apply your company's color scheme and label charts clearly. Avoid clutter by focusing on the 5-10 most critical metrics.

  • Template Library: Save your master template and create copies for specific use cases (e.g., board reports, team stand-ups). An AI spreadsheet can help generate variations quickly.

By investing in a solid template, you ensure that every automated report is polished, accurate, and instantly understandable.

How Can You Schedule and Distribute Automated KPI Reports?

Scheduling and distribution turn a static dashboard into a proactive communication tool. Modern AI spreadsheets offer built-in options to share reports on autopilot.

Common distribution methods:

  • Email Digests: Schedule PDF or snapshot exports to be sent to stakeholder email lists at regular intervals (e.g., every Monday morning).

  • Slack/Teams Integration: Post updates directly to designated channels, keeping teams aligned in their communication hubs.

  • Embedded Dashboards: Share a secure, view-only link that displays the live dashboard, ideal for internal portals or client reporting.

  • Alert-Based Notifications: Configure triggers to send instant alerts via email or Slack when a KPI breaches a predefined threshold.

Pro Tip: Tailor the frequency and format to the audience. Executives may prefer a weekly summary, while operational teams need daily live access. Automation here, as highlighted in AI Marketing Automation guides, ensures timely insights without manual follow-up.

What Are Common Pitfalls and How to Validate Automated KPIs?

Automation introduces new risks if not properly managed. Here are common pitfalls and how to avoid them:

  • Garbage In, Garbage Out: If source data is flawed, automation amplifies errors. Solution: Implement data quality checks at the connection stage and use AI to identify anomalies.

  • Over-Automation: Automating every metric can create noise. Solution: Focus on the vital few KPIs that drive decisions. Regularly prune unused reports.

  • Lack of Ownership: When reports run on autopilot, no one feels responsible. Solution: Designate a report owner to validate outputs monthly.

  • Ignoring Context: Automated numbers lack narrative. Solution: Use AI to generate brief insights or add manual commentary sections to explain trends.

Validation Checklist:

  1. Spot-Check Calculations: Monthly, manually verify a random sample of KPI values against raw data.

  2. Monitor Refresh Logs: Ensure data pipelines are running without failures.

  3. Review Alert Logic: Confirm threshold alerts are firing correctly for edge cases.

  4. Solicit Feedback: Ask report consumers if the data matches their expectations and other systems.

Following this process builds confidence in your automated reporting system.

How can I automate KPI reports from multiple data sources without a BI tool?

You can automate KPI reports without a traditional BI tool by using an AI-powered spreadsheet like Sourcetable. It connects directly to databases and SaaS applications, uses AI to clean and merge data, allows you to build formulas and dashboards, and includes scheduling features to email or share reports automatically-all within a familiar spreadsheet interface.

What tools should I use to combine SaaS and database data into one KPI report?

Use an AI spreadsheet that offers native connectors for both SaaS tools (e.g., Salesforce, Google Ads) and databases (e.g., PostgreSQL, Snowflake). These tools, like Sourcetable, can pull live data from each source into a single workspace, where AI assists in joining and transforming the data into a unified dataset for reporting, eliminating manual ETL processes.

How do AI spreadsheets help clean and merge KPI data automatically?

AI spreadsheets help clean and merge data by using machine learning to suggest transformations. For example, you can prompt the AI to 'remove duplicates,' 'standardize date formats,' or 'join these tables on customer ID.' The AI identifies patterns and inconsistencies, then applies the corrections across your dataset, saving hours of manual data preprocessing work.

Can I schedule automated KPI reports to email or Slack?

Yes, most modern AI spreadsheets include scheduling and distribution features. You can set up automated reports to be sent as PDF attachments via email to a list of recipients on a daily, weekly, or monthly basis. They also often integrate with Slack, allowing you to post report snapshots or alerts directly to specific channels without manual intervention.

What are best practices for designing automated KPI dashboards?

Best practices include: 1) Focusing on 5-10 key metrics that align with business goals, 2) Using a clean, consistent layout with clear labels and company branding, 3) Building dynamic date ranges so reports auto-update for new periods, 4) Separating data, calculations, and visualizations into logical sheets, and 5) Regularly validating data accuracy and soliciting user feedback to ensure the dashboard remains useful.

Key Takeaways

  • Analysts spend up to 40% of their time on manual report updates, a drain automation eliminates.

  • AI spreadsheets can connect to multiple data sources, clean and merge data with AI, and schedule reports without coding.

  • Validating automated KPIs with monthly spot-checks is crucial to maintain data trust and accuracy.

  • Scheduling distribution to email or Slack ensures stakeholders receive timely insights automatically.

  • Building reusable templates in 2026 focuses on dynamic, AI-assisted designs that scale with business needs.

Sources

  1. According to operations and RevOps benchmarks, analysts spend a large share of their time updating recurring reports. [Source]
  2. Data indicates that manually maintained KPI spreadsheets are prone to errors that impact decision-making. [Source]
  3. 2026 tooling surveys reveal growing adoption of lightweight, AI-driven reporting stacks over complex BI systems. [Source]
  4. Guides on connecting SQL databases to cloud spreadsheets highlight the efficiency of direct integrations for live dashboards. [Source]
  5. Best practices for automated data visualization emphasize clear, consistent templates for stakeholder reports. [Source]
How can I automate KPI reports from multiple data sources without a BI tool?
You can automate KPI reports without a traditional BI tool by using an AI-powered spreadsheet like Sourcetable. It connects directly to databases and SaaS applications, uses AI to clean and merge data, allows you to build formulas and dashboards, and includes scheduling features to email or share reports automatically-all within a familiar spreadsheet interface.
What tools should I use to combine SaaS and database data into one KPI report?
Use an AI spreadsheet that offers native connectors for both SaaS tools (e.g., Salesforce, Google Ads) and databases (e.g., PostgreSQL, Snowflake). These tools, like Sourcetable, can pull live data from each source into a single workspace, where AI assists in joining and transforming the data into a unified dataset for reporting, eliminating manual ETL processes.
How do AI spreadsheets help clean and merge KPI data automatically?
AI spreadsheets help clean and merge data by using machine learning to suggest transformations. For example, you can prompt the AI to 'remove duplicates,' 'standardize date formats,' or 'join these tables on customer ID.' The AI identifies patterns and inconsistencies, then applies the corrections across your dataset, saving hours of manual data preprocessing work.
Can I schedule automated KPI reports to email or Slack?
Yes, most modern AI spreadsheets include scheduling and distribution features. You can set up automated reports to be sent as PDF attachments via email to a list of recipients on a daily, weekly, or monthly basis. They also often integrate with Slack, allowing you to post report snapshots or alerts directly to specific channels without manual intervention.
What are best practices for designing automated KPI dashboards?
Best practices include: 1) Focusing on 5-10 key metrics that align with business goals, 2) Using a clean, consistent layout with clear labels and company branding, 3) Building dynamic date ranges so reports auto-update for new periods, 4) Separating data, calculations, and visualizations into logical sheets, and 5) Regularly validating data accuracy and soliciting user feedback to ensure the dashboard remains useful.
Eoin McMillan

Eoin McMillan

Currently: Building an AI spreadsheet for the next billion people

Eoin McMillan is building an AI spreadsheet for the next billion people as Founder and Head of Product at Sourcetable. An alumnus of The Australian National University, he leads product strategy and engineering for Sourcetable’s AI spreadsheet, launching features like Deep Research and expanding the default file upload limit to 10GB to streamline large-file analysis. He focuses on making powerful data analysis and automation accessible to analysts and operators.

Share this article

Sourcetable Logo
Ready to get started?

Experience the future of spreadsheets

Drop CSV